Quote By Abraham Lincoln

If the great American people will only keep their temper, on both sides of the line, the troubles will come to an end, and the question which now distracts the country will be settled just as surely as all other difficulties of like character which have originated in this government have been adjusted.

Abraham Lincoln

Explanation Of The Quote

Abraham Lincoln appeals to the American people to maintain composure and restraint amidst national divisions. He expresses confidence that national conflicts can be resolved through reasoned dialogue and mutual understanding. Lincoln’s quote reflects his optimism and faith in the democratic process, urging moderation and patience in addressing contentious issues. It underscores his belief in the resilience of American democracy and the capacity of its citizens to reconcile differences for the common good.
